Trump shares details on machine that disinfects masks

hypatia-h_7217110002fb0e12b1c4c3640e65f69c-h_2c32ccc3ae8ee738af5f0b57e5c4406a_preview-1

(CNN) https://livestream.com/accounts/25723746/events/8522569/videos/203779000 President Trump said the Food and Drug Administration approved a machine that could disinfect N95 masks, so health care providers could reuse them.

"Each machine now can disinfect 120,000 masks per day," Trump said today. "Now, think of that. Each machine can disinfect 120,000 masks per day. It will be just like a new one. It can go up to about 20 times for each mask."

He continued: "So each mask can go through this process 20 times. And they have two in Ohio, one in New York, and one will soon be shipped to Seattle, Washington. And also to Washington, DC. So that's going to make a tremendous difference on the masks."

The FDA approved the use of the mask cleaning machine produced by Columbus based Battelle earlier Monday.
